Donahue presents a collection of style and formatting guidelines designed to help writers express the special notations, terms, and concepts found in the discipline of music. A glossary of typographic terms, a bibliography, and a comprehensive index help make this a valuable resource for students, scholars, teachers, and writers.

Thomas Donahue is a musician and instrument builder. He is author of Gerhard Brunzema: His Work and His Influence (Scarecrow, 1998), Anthony Newman: Music, Energy, Healing Spirit (Scarecrow, 2000), and A Guide to Musical Temperament (Scarecrow, 2005).
